Output ec92832612126a740cf591ff3f4b3e6782938c9bcad2a78087f7fd53e804fe80:1

value
36561285
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d674e13599929516e299295c7e6b39df6153b8c9 OP_EQUAL
address
3MExYYLPxwbCcpjQpiYUcp5RHDRzwUix37
transaction
ec92832612126a740cf591ff3f4b3e6782938c9bcad2a78087f7fd53e804fe80
confirmations
291100
spent
true